Transaction cd7cc3cb84ab527d4ea120b33df432ec1bc79c13e7b3c55e209d31f06c451f36
1 Input
2 Outputs
- cd7cc3cb84ab527d4ea120b33df432ec1bc79c13e7b3c55e209d31f06c451f36:0
- cd7cc3cb84ab527d4ea120b33df432ec1bc79c13e7b3c55e209d31f06c451f36:1
value 941766
address 38fpjevy69wk5ZFHkS5DAtMczf6fWRzMDt
value 2167880
address 18e1zxKCLpUhnrtFYR184kcjXAFk6Vgkm3